From 81daf2aa0ca19060a5b2be9fe12e542a579402f4 Mon Sep 17 00:00:00 2001 From: Niklas Meinzer Date: Wed, 8 Oct 2025 10:19:37 +0200 Subject: [PATCH] Add rudimentary green theme --- new-registration-app/static/css/allmende.css | 29 ++++++++++++++++++++ new-registration-app/templates/base.html | 1 + 2 files changed, 30 insertions(+) create mode 100644 new-registration-app/static/css/allmende.css diff --git a/new-registration-app/static/css/allmende.css b/new-registration-app/static/css/allmende.css new file mode 100644 index 0000000..0fb6fef --- /dev/null +++ b/new-registration-app/static/css/allmende.css @@ -0,0 +1,29 @@ +/* theme.css */ +/* Green Bootstrap Theme */ + +:root { + --bs-primary: #198754; + --bs-primary-rgb: 25, 135, 84; + --bs-success: #198754; + --bs-success-rgb: 25, 135, 84; + --bs-link-color: var(--bs-primary); + --bs-link-hover-color: #146c43; +} + +/* Explicit fallback overrides for older versions (<=5.2) */ +.btn-primary { + color: #fff; + background-color: #198754; + border-color: #198754; +} +.btn-primary:hover { + color: #fff; + background-color: #157347; + border-color: #146c43; +} +.btn-primary:focus, +.btn-primary:active { + color: #fff; + background-color: #146c43; + border-color: #125c39; +} diff --git a/new-registration-app/templates/base.html b/new-registration-app/templates/base.html index f73ab1a..0272fa3 100644 --- a/new-registration-app/templates/base.html +++ b/new-registration-app/templates/base.html @@ -6,6 +6,7 @@ Allmende Essen +